Rooted in modern trucking culture, Truck Driver Games simulate the daily rhythms, responsibilities, and routes of professional long-haul and regional hauling. These experiences mirror real logistics operations—delivering goods across state lines, managing schedules, navigating traffic, and adapting to unpredictable conditions—offering both entertainment and honest insight into the profession.

At their core, these games replicate real driving mechanics in accessible ways: managing fuel efficiency, time-sensitive deliveries, department store stops, weather impacts, and rest period rules. Without graphic or explicit content, the focus stays on strategy, realism, and controlled decision-making—mirroring both the complexity and pace of truck driving without crossing sensitive boundaries.
The experience blends simple controls with strategic depth, allowing players to explore what it takes to succeed in a profession defined by responsibility, independence, and realism.
